What are tides?

Back

Tides are the rise and fall of sea levels caused by the gravitational forces exerted by the Moon and the Sun on Earth.

What is a neap tide?

Back

A neap tide occurs when the Sun and Moon are at right angles to each other, resulting in the least difference between high and low tides.

What is a spring tide?

Back

A spring tide occurs when the Earth, Moon, and Sun are aligned, resulting in the greatest difference between high and low tides.

Why does the Moon have a greater influence on tides than the Sun?

Back

The Moon has a greater influence because it is closer to the Earth, despite being smaller than the Sun.
